Great opportunity to own a spacious townhome in City of Decatur! Located in Glendale Townhome community. Value priced for Buyer to make cosmetic improvements. Foyer entry with a bedroom and bath on the main level. Large separate living room, separate dining room, and ample kitchen. Second floor has two additional bedrooms, full bathroom, and plenty of storage. Easy stroll to Glendale Park. Low HOA fees!

RS-17
Single-Family Residential District
The purpose of this district is to provide for single-family residential development at a density not to exceed 17 units per acre.
